What I Look for in Material Quality

The first thing I check is the material. In my opinion, a fire pit ring should be made from heavy-duty steel or another durable metal that can handle high heat. I always prefer thicker steel because it tends to last longer and resist warping better. If the ring has a heat-resistant finish or coating, that is another plus for me because it helps slow down rust and wear.

Why Thickness Matters to Me

I pay close attention to the thickness of the ring because it affects both durability and performance. A thicker ring usually feels sturdier and holds up better over time. From my experience, thinner rings may be cheaper, but they can wear out faster when exposed to repeated high heat. If I want something long-lasting, I look for a ring built to handle regular use.

How I Think About Shape and Design

Not all fire pit rings are designed the same way. I like to consider whether I want a simple round ring, a deeper insert, or a decorative style. For me, a basic round ring is the easiest to install and use, while a more decorative one can improve the look of my outdoor space. I also check whether the design allows for good airflow, since that helps the fire burn more efficiently.

Installation is Important in My Decision

I always think about how easy the ring will be to install. Some 48 inch fire pit rings are meant to sit inside a stone or brick surround, while others are better for a simple ground setup. I prefer a model that matches my project so I do not have to make extra adjustments. If the ring comes with clear installation instructions, that makes my decision easier.

What I Consider About Safety

Safety is one of my biggest concerns. I look for a ring that has a stable structure and enough depth to help contain the fire. I also make sure the materials can handle high temperatures without cracking or bending. In my experience, choosing the right location and keeping proper clearance around the fire pit is just as important as the ring itself.

Why I Check for Rust Resistance

Since fire pits are usually kept outdoors, rust resistance matters a lot to me. I always look for a finish that can stand up to rain, moisture, and general weather exposure. Even if I cover the fire pit when not in use, I still want a ring that can handle the elements. A rust-resistant finish gives me more confidence that my purchase will last longer.

How I Compare Price and Value

When I shop for a 48 inch fire pit ring, I do not just look for the lowest price. I try to balance cost with durability, thickness, and finish quality. In my experience, spending a little more upfront often saves me money later because I do not have to replace the ring as soon. I always ask myself whether the product feels like a good long-term value.
